What is the salary of a Plant Process Control Electrician? In the United States, a Plant Process Control Electrician earns an average salary of $167,076. The salary range for a Plant Process Control Electrician is usually between $147,642 and $178,683 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$187,269. The highest Plant Process Control Electrician salary in the United States was $216,495. The average hourly pay for a Plant Process Control Electrician is $80.33.
